Next.js
Vercel tarafından geliştirilen React framework'ü. SSR, SSG, API Routes ve daha fazlası.
Next.js, React uygulamaları için production-ready bir framework'tür. Server-side rendering (SSR), static site generation (SSG), API routes ve file-based routing gibi özellikler sunar.
Next.js ile Ne Yapabilirsiniz?
SEO-friendly web siteleri, e-ticaret platformları, blog ve içerik siteleri, full-stack web uygulamaları geliştirebilirsiniz.
Next.js Özellikleri
Server-Side Rendering
SEO ve performans için SSR
Static Site Generation
Build-time sayfa oluşturma
API Routes
Built-in backend API'ler
File-based Routing
Otomatik routing
Image Optimization
Otomatik görsel optimizasyonu
App Router
React Server Components
Nerelerde Kullanılır?
SEO-Focused Siteler
Blog, haber siteleri
TikTok, Twitch webE-Ticaret
Online mağazalar
Hype, commerce sitesMarketing Siteleri
Landing pages
Vercel, NotionFull-stack Apps
API + Frontend
SaaS uygulamalarıArtıları ve Eksileri
Avantajlar
- SSR/SSG ile mükemmel SEO
- Zero config başlangıç
- Vercel ile kolay deployment
- Image ve font optimizasyonu
- Full-stack geliştirme
Dezavantajlar
- Vercel dışı hosting karmaşık
- Build süreleri uzun olabilir
- App Router öğrenme eğrisi
Öğrenmek İçin Ne Bilmeli?
React
Component, hooks, state
JavaScript/TypeScript
Modern JS bilgisi
Sıkça Sorulan Sorular
Next.js React'tan farklı mı?
Next.js, React'ın üzerine kurulu bir framework. React sadece UI, Next.js routing, SSR, API routes gibi ekstra özellikler ekler.
Pages Router mı App Router mı?
Yeni projeler için App Router önerilir. Mevcut projelerde Pages Router hala destekleniyor.
Next.js ile Proje mi Geliştirmek İstiyorsunuz?
Uzman ekibimizle projelerinizi hayata geçirin veya Akademi'de öğrenmeye başlayın.